Step 2: Water Extraction

Using our state-of-the-art equipment, we'll extract as much water as possible from your floors. This is a crucial step in the process, as it helps prevent further damage and reduces the risk of mold and mildew growth. We'll use a combination of wet vacuums and pumps to extract the water. Our team will monitor the moisture levels to ensure the area is dry and safe. We'll work efficiently to get the job done quickly.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your floors. This step is critical in preventing mold and mildew growth and ensuring your floors are safe and dry. We'll use high-velocity fans and dehumidifiers to dry the area. Floor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) Yes No You can likely handle a small spill on your own with a mop and towels.
Large water spill (over 1 gallon) No Yes A large water spill can cause significant damage and needs professional equipment and expertise to fix.
Water damage to multiple rooms or floors No Yes Water damage to multiple rooms or floors needs professional expertise and equipment to fix and prevent further damage.
Visible signs of mold or mildew No Yes Mold and mildew can be hazardous to your health and needs professional equipment and expertise to remove and prevent future growth.
Water damage to electrical systems or appliances No Yes Water damage to electrical systems or appliances can be hazardous and needs professional expertise to fix and prevent further damage.
